TarEntry Classe

Definizione

Definisce il comportamento principale di una voce tar da un archivio.

public ref class TarEntry abstract
public abstract class TarEntry
type TarEntry = class
Public MustInherit Class TarEntry
Ereditarietà
TarEntry
Derivato

Commenti

Tutte le proprietà esposte da questa classe sono supportate dai formati V7, Ustar, Paxe Gnu.

Proprietà

Checksum

Checksum di tutti i campi in questa voce. Il valore è diverso da zero quando la voce viene letta da un archivio esistente o dopo che la voce viene scritta in un nuovo archivio.

DataOffset

Ottiene la posizione iniziale del flusso di dati corrispondente al flusso di archiviazione.

DataStream

Ottiene o imposta la sezione dati di questa voce. Se il EntryType non supporta i dati contenenti dati, restituisce null.

EntryType

Ottiene il tipo di oggetto file system rappresentato da questa voce.

Format

Formato della voce.

Gid

Ottiene o imposta l'ID del gruppo proprietario del file rappresentato da questa voce.

Length

Quando il EntryType indica una voce che può contenere dati, ottiene la lunghezza in byte di tali dati.

LinkName

Quando il EntryType indica un SymbolicLink o un HardLink, ottiene o imposta il percorso di destinazione del collegamento.

Mode

Ottiene o imposta le autorizzazioni per i file Unix del file rappresentato da questa voce.

ModificationTime

Ottiene o imposta l'ultima volta che il contenuto del file rappresentato da questa voce è stato modificato.

Name

Ottiene o imposta il nome della voce, che include il percorso relativo e il nome file.

Uid

Ottiene o imposta l'ID dell'utente proprietario del file rappresentato da questa voce.

Metodi

Equals(Object)

Determina se l'oggetto specificato è uguale all'oggetto corrente.

(Ereditato da Object)
ExtractToFile(String, Boolean)

Estrae il file o la directory corrente nel file system. I collegamenti simbolici e i collegamenti reali non vengono estratti.

ExtractToFileAsync(String, Boolean, CancellationToken)

Estrae in modo asincrono la voce corrente nel file system.

GetHashCode()

Funge da funzione hash predefinita.

(Ereditato da Object)
GetType()

Ottiene il Type dell'istanza corrente.

(Ereditato da Object)
MemberwiseClone()

Crea una copia superficiale del Objectcorrente.

(Ereditato da Object)
ToString()

Restituisce una stringa che rappresenta la voce corrente.

Si applica a